Alameda Superior Court Judge Kelli Evans ’94 was sworn in as the California Supreme Court’s newest associate justice in January.

Gov. Gavin Newsom appointed Sacramento Superior Court Judges Stacy Boulware-Eurie ’95 and Shama Hakim Mesiwala ’98 to the Third District Court of Appeal. Boulware-Eurie was the keynote speaker for UC Davis Law’s Class of 2022 Commencement. Mesiwala is a longtime UC Davis Law adjunct professor. 

San Diego Superior Court Judge Jose Castillo ’06 has been nominated to serve as an associate justice of the Fourth District Court of Appeal, Division One. Castillo is a former King Hall Alumni Association board member. 

Newsom appointed Trisha Hirashima ’04 as a Placer Superior Court judge. Hirashima previously served as a senior legal research attorney and part-time commissioner for the court.  

Stephen Lau ’02 has been appointed to the Sacramento Superior Court. General counsel at the Sacramento County Employees’ Retirement System from 2019-2022, Lau previously served as assistant general counsel at the California Department of Business Oversight. 

Mona Nemat ’04 has become a Riverside Superior Court judge. A partner at Best Best & Krieger in 2022 and from 2007-2013, Nemat was a shareholder at the law office of Brissman & Nemat from 2013-22. 

Newsom appointed Fernando Valle ’02 as an Orange County Superior Court judge. Valle previously was an Orange County senior public defender. 

Esmeralda Zendejas ’06 has been appointed as a San Joaquin Superior Court judge. Zendejas previously worked as an attorney for the Department of Industrial Relations, as a deputy attorney general, and in several positions with California Rural Legal Assistance, Inc. 

United States Attorney General Merrick Garland appointed Joyce L. Noche ’99 as a judge for the Santa Ana Immigration Court. From 2018-2022, Noche was the legal services director at Immigrant Defenders Law Center.
